Kapua Point
Kapua Point is a cape in Auckland Region, North Island. Kapua Point is situated nearby to the locality Arapaoa, as well as near the hamlet Whakapirau.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Matakohe is a settlement in Northland, New Zealand. The Matakohe River is a short river which runs from the north into the Arapaoa River, which is part of the Kaipara Harbour.
